Police find man shot to death in car in Roanoke

police car bigstock

ROANOKE, VA – On January 31, 2021 at approximately 3:45 a.m., Roanoke Police were notified of a person with a gunshot wound in the 700 block of Hunt Avenue NW. Responding officers located an adult male unresponsive in a vehicle with a serious gunshot wound. Roanoke Fire-EMS transported him to Carilion Roanoke Memorial Hospital where he was pronounced deceased. The victim’s identity will be released after next of kin is notified. No suspects were located on scene and no arrests have been made at this time. This is an active homicide investigation.
